+float SX127x_lora::get_symbol_period()
+{
+    float khz = 0;
+    
+    if (m_xcvr.type == SX1276) {
+        switch (RegModemConfig.sx1276bits.Bw) {
+            case 0: khz = 7.8; break;
+            case 1: khz = 10.4; break;
+            case 2: khz = 15.6; break;
+            case 3: khz = 20.8; break;
+            case 4: khz = 31.25; break;
+            case 5: khz = 41.7; break;
+            case 6: khz = 62.5; break;
+            case 7: khz = 125; break;
+            case 8: khz = 250; break;
+            case 9: khz = 500; break;
+        }
+    } else if (m_xcvr.type == SX1272) {
+        switch (RegModemConfig.sx1272bits.Bw) {
+            case 0: khz = 125; break;
+            case 1: khz = 250; break;
+            case 2: khz = 500; break;            
+        }
+    }
+    
+    // return symbol duration in milliseconds
+    return (1 << RegModemConfig2.sx1276bits.SpreadingFactor) / khz; 
+}
